Transaction ec13621247590b8055c7e5a5e76b46e1d1e9c693f2d9bc04af9f48fe7d14914b

1 Input
2 Outputs
  • ec13621247590b8055c7e5a5e76b46e1d1e9c693f2d9bc04af9f48fe7d14914b:0
  • value  1038500
    address  1PnhU9ftUcTnARr3iXKDqgsAfRkZYwVJZc
  • ec13621247590b8055c7e5a5e76b46e1d1e9c693f2d9bc04af9f48fe7d14914b:1
  • value  54348457
    address  18FyUrTkRE9cCLXX1x78XzCRQ8T87vSkG4